Home » Michigan » Lowell » Three Brothers Pizza » Directions

Driving Directions to Three Brothers Pizza in Lowell, MI

Three Brothers Pizza is located at 1004 W Main St Ste 4, Lowell, MI-49331. Get step by step driving directions to Three Brothers Pizza.

Starting Address

Three Brothers Pizza Location Map

The following map shows the location of Three Brothers Pizza

View details of Three Brothers Pizza.